The quintuple set ($68) consists of the Lacto-Fermented Pineapple Galette, a homage to the pineapple tarts, and this is made from a flaky galette pastry with demerara sugar, pineapple jam and layered with fermented pineapples that has been grilled and glazed with pineapple juice. The finishing touch is topped with locally sourced cress and a dollop of crème fraiche.

Another key component of the lunar new year is the kumquats, and the patisserie has baked a Kumquat and Sea Buckthorn Danish made with a sourdough base and glazed with vanilla, apricot and topped with mandarin custard and semi-dried confit kumquat slices for that balance of sweet and tarty flavour. A popular snack that many munches on during visitations are hae bee hiams and the Hae Bee Hiam Laminated Donut Roll in this set is filled with a hae bee hiam cream cheese custard, rolled in with parmesan and shrimp floss, topped with crispy fried shrimp. One bite of this and you will keep going back for more.

The final two pastries, the Sweet Potato & Yuzu Brioche Bun and Chrysanthemum & Pear Custard Flan round up the quintuple set. The former is filled with a yuzu jam and brown sugar nutmeg cream while the latter is filled with a chrysanthemum and vanilla infused custard that is then topped with a pear, ginger and mascarpone cream. A decadent treat that pairs well with a cup of afternoon tea.
